Set during World War II , the story follows Johnny 'Red' Redburn, a British pilot leading the Falcon Squadron unit of the Soviet Air Forces on the Eastern Front.October 3, 1959 • 45m. A man suddenly turns up in Dodge City claiming to be Billy Crale, the long-lost son of a well-to-do local widow. Matt knows that Billy Crale was reported dead during the Civil War, and he becomes highly concerned for Mrs. Crale's safety when he confirms that the man is actually a onetime outlaw known as Johnny Red. Here's what they had to say. The Main Street Allianc...Gunsmoke is an American Western television series developed by Charles Marquis Warren and based on the radio program of the same name. The series ran for 20 seasons, making it the longest-running Western in television history. Johnny Red: Directed by Buzz Kulik. With James Arness, Dennis Weaver, Milburn Stone, Amanda Blake. A man unexpectedly turns up in Dodge City claiming to be Billy Crale, the long-lost son of a well-to-do local widow. Matt knows that the war office reported Billy Crale killed in the Civil War at the battle of Shiloh, so he becomes highly concerned for Mrs. Crale's safety when he confirms that ...
